The Argentine makes history.

Real Madrid is set to play Marseille in the first round of the UEFA Champions League on Tuesday, September 16, and one player has already made headlines.

Details: Argentine winger Franco Mastantuono has become the youngest player to start a UEFA Champions League match for Real Madrid, at just 18 years and 33 days. He broke the record previously held by Brazilian forward Endrick, who was 18 years and 73 days old.

Advertisement

In the starting lineup, Vinícius Júnior will not play, as he has been placed on the bench for this match.

Reminder: The game between Real Madrid and Marseille begins at 21:00 CET. Tensions in Madrid have already escalated, with clashes between fans and police leading to incidents before the match.
